The Human epidermal growth factor receptor 2 (HER2) – Human epidermal growth factor receptor 3 (HER3) heterodimer is a potent oncogenic signaling unit within the ErbB family of receptor tyrosine kinases [PMC, 2015; PMC, 2014]. While HER2 lacks a known ligand and HER3 has impaired intrinsic kinase activity, their heterodimerization creates the most active signaling complex in the family [PubMed, 2005; PMC, 2014]. HER3 serves as a critical scaffold, containing six docking sites for the p85 subunit of phosphoinositide 3-kinase (PI3K), which leads to robust activation of the PI3K/Akt/mTOR pathway [PMC, 2015; PMC, 2009]. This pathway is a primary driver of cell survival, proliferation, and resistance to various cancer therapies [PMC, 2014; Clin Cancer Res, 2014]. The HER2-HER3 heterodimer is frequently overexpressed in breast, gastric, and lung cancers, where it correlates with poor prognosis [ResearchGate, 2017; PMC, 2023]. Therapeutic targeting involves agents like pertuzumab, which specifically inhibits the dimerization interface, and bispecific antibodies like zenocutuzumab that target both receptors to prevent signaling [Clin Cancer Res, 2014; PMC, 2024].
